The Brighter Financial Blueprint Podcast explores advanced retirement planning, tax-efficient income strategies, Roth conversions, estate planning, trust planning, long-term care considerations, and legacy-focused wealth design for affluent families and business owners. Hosted by Megan Clark, RICP®, CEO of Clark Financial Solutions, this podcast is designed to help listeners think beyond investments and build a more intentional financial strategy for retirement and beyond. Each episode delivers thoughtful financial education focused on: ● retirement income planning, ● tax bracket engineering, ● Roth conversion timing, ● estate and trust planning, ● wealth protection, ● and long-term financial sustainability. Charitable Giving Strategies and Legacy Planning for Affluent Families
Jun 26, 20269 minS1
Charitable giving can be more than generosity — it can also become part of a thoughtful retirement and legacy strategy. In this episode, Megan Clark discusses Qualified Charitable Distributions, donor advised funds, family foundations, and how affluent families can use philanthropy to support both tax efficiency and generational wealth education. Through practical examples and personal stories, this episode explores how giving with intention can create impact far beyond finances. https://clarkfinancialplanning.com/broadcasts/
